Saukville has a population of 4,463, making it the 5705th largest place we list in United States. It is in Wisconsin.

Saukville holds under a tenth of one per cent of United States's 349,035,494 people. New York City, the largest place we list there, is 1973 times its size. Twenty years earlier the World Gazetteer recorded 4,185, a rise of 7%.

The 2005 figure comes from the World Gazetteer archive restored on this site. The two sources may draw the settlement's boundary differently, so treat the change as indicative rather than exact. Why figures differ.
